Primary Yankees Ownership Group

The principal owner of the Yankees is Hal Steinbrenner, who oversees the Yankees operations as managing general partner. He is part of the Steinbrenner family, which has controlled the franchise since purchasing it from CBS in 1973. While Hal leads day to day decisions, the Yankees ownership net worth is actually a family affair, with multiple relatives holding stakes. This structure helps the team maintain stability and long term planning across generations.

Historical Acquisitions and Wealth Building

The Yankees have been purchased at key moments that shaped their legacy, and each transaction affected the owner net worth significantly. In 1973, the family bought the team for around 10 million dollars, a figure that looks small compared to today. Over the decades, the growth of the Yankees brand turned that investment into a multibillion dollar empire. The rise in Yankees owner net worth mirrors the team on field success and its expanding commercial reach.

Revenue Streams and Valuation Drivers Yankees owner net worth is driven by television deals, merchandise, ticket sales, and sponsorship agreements. The team earns hundreds of millions each year from media contracts, making it one of the most cash rich clubs in baseball. Global brand recognition and a historic stadium also push valuations higher. As the franchise earns more, the wealth attributed to the ownership group grows in tandem.
